1. Ensures Compliance with Arizona Safety Codes
Arizona has strict electrical and building codes designed to protect property owners and occupants. Licensed lighting contractors are trained to follow these regulations and ensure every installation meets legal standards.
This helps prevent:
- Electrical hazards
- Fire risks
- Failed inspections
- Legal complications
Proper compliance also protects your property’s resale value.

4. Provides Insurance and Liability Coverage
Licensed lighting contractors carry proper insurance and bonding. This protects you from financial responsibility in case of accidents, property damage, or worker injuries during the project.
Without proper coverage, homeowners may face unexpected legal and medical expenses.
5. Improves Energy Efficiency and Cost Savings
Professional contractors understand how to design lighting systems that maximize energy efficiency, especially in Arizona’s high-temperature environment.
They help you:
- Choose energy-saving LED fixtures
- Optimize light placement
- Reduce power consumption
- Lower long-term utility costs
These benefits make your property more attractive and economical to maintain.
